22问答网
所有问题
当前搜索:
判定覆盖和条件覆盖的区别
静态测试和白盒测试有什么
区别
答:
白盒测试:白盒测试目的是确定实际运行状态与预期状态是否一致。三、方法不同 1、静态测试:静态测试的方法包括代码检查、静态结构分析、代码质量度量等。2、白盒测试:白盒测试的方法有代码检查法、静态结构分析法、静态质量度量法、逻辑覆盖法、基本路径测试法、域测试、符号测试、路径
覆盖和
程序变异。
修正
条件
逻辑
判定
问题,请给出详细解答,谢谢!
答:
MC/DC是Modified Condition/Decision Coverage(MC/DC)的缩写,含义是修正
条件判定覆盖
MCDC:条件表示不含有布尔操作符号的布尔表达式;判定表示由条件和零或者很多布尔操作符号所组成的一个布尔表达式;而修正条件判定覆盖方法要求在一个程序中每一种输入输出至少得出现一次,在程序中的每一个条件必须产生所有...
系统模块
与
程序模块
的区别
答:
一般会有一个输入值,一个输入值,和期望值做比较。白盒测试主要应用在单元测试阶段,主要是对代码级的测试,针对程序内部逻辑结构,测试手段有:语句覆盖、
判定覆盖
、
条件覆盖
、路径覆盖、条件组合覆盖 集成测试主要用来测试模块与模块之间的接口,同时还要测试一些主要业务功能。
设计测试用例分别实验语句覆盖、
条件覆盖
面和
判定覆盖
。
答:
语句覆盖两组就可 a=160,b=210 a=40,b=10;
判定覆盖
:用上面的例子也可。
条件覆盖
a=150,b=200 a=150,b=190 a=149,b=200 a=149,b=190
条件
组合
覆盖
是查错能力最强的吗
答:
是。逻辑
覆盖
标准中,查错能力最强的是条件组合,覆盖准则最强的是路径覆盖。发现错误能力最弱的是语句覆盖。条件组合覆盖是指设计若干个测试用例,运行被测程序,使得每个
判定
中
条件的
各种组合都至少执行一次。
逻辑覆盖标准包括( )。①判定覆盖 ②语句覆盖 ③
条件判定覆盖
④修正条 ...
答:
【答案】:D 本题考查白盒测试的逻辑覆盖测试法的基础知识 逻辑覆盖标准包括语句覆盖、
判定覆盖
(又称为分支覆盖)、
条件覆盖
、条件
判定 覆盖
、修正条件判定覆盖、条件组合覆盖等。
逻辑覆盖标准包括()。①判定覆盖 ②语句覆盖③
条件判定覆盖
④修正条 ...
答:
【答案】:D 本题考查白盒覆盖测试基础知识。白盒测试设计中,共有语句覆盖,
判定覆盖
,
条件覆盖
,判定/条件覆盖,修正条件判定覆盖,条件组合
覆盖和
路径覆盖,并且强度依次加强。
白盒测试用例练习题(1)
答:
白盒测试用例练习1.为以下所示的程序段设计一组测试用例,要求分别满足语句覆盖、
判定覆盖
、
条件覆盖
、判定/条件覆盖、组合
覆盖和
路径覆盖,并画出相应的程序流程图。voidDoWork(intx,inty,intz){intk=0,j=0;if((x>3)&&(z/语句块1}if((x==4)||(y>5)){j=x*y+10;}//语句块2j=j%3;...
...a&b)‖(c&d),需要( )个测试用例才能完成
条件
组合
覆盖
。
答:
【答案】:C 本题考查条件组合覆盖法的基础知识。在白盒测试法中,选择足够的测试用例,使得每个判定中条件的各种可能组合都至少出现一次。显然,满足“条件组合覆盖”的测试用例是一定满足“
判定覆盖
”、“
条件覆盖
”和“判定/条件覆盖”的。条件组合
覆盖的
测试用例数为:2^n,本题条件为a&b、c&d共2...
最新的软件测试方法有哪些?
答:
白盒测试法的覆盖标准有逻辑覆盖、循环
覆盖和
基本路径测试。其中逻辑覆盖包括语句覆盖、
判定覆盖
、
条件覆盖
、判定/条件覆盖、条件组合覆盖和路径覆盖。 白盒测试是知道产品内部工作过程,可通过测试来检测产品内部动作是否按照规格说明书的规定正常进行,按照程序内部的结构测试程序,检验程序中的每条通路是否都有能按预定要求...
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
其他人还搜